The Vile Village

An entire village acts as a guardian for the Baudelaire children. The children choose an adoption program called "V.F.D.," which stands for Village of Fowl Devotees. They live with the local handyman Hector, a chronic social rebel with a secret library and plans to escape the staunch community via his hot air mobile home.

Village members later report that Count Olaf has been captured. Ironically, it isn't the wicked villain this time around, but instead, a man named Jacques Snicket. The orphans try to help Jacques to no avail. He ends up dead because of the real Count Olaf, who's scheming with Esmé Squalor to trap the siblings. Hunted down by a mob, the Baudelaires find the Quagmires. Hector helps the Quagmires but fails to rescue the Baudelaire children. Isadora and Duncan throw down notebooks from Hector's hot air mobile home, which contain notes about the V.F.D.
